Why Africa

Why Africa

Africa! Africa! Africa!
Once considered, the bosom of unity
Often regarded as the mother of humanity
A center for the respect of human dignity
A people embedded with the spirit of integrity
Usually seen as the world’s mirror of charity
Characterized by the true meaning of hospitality
We were once referred to as pillars of morality

What a plague on Africa?
Africans are now killing Africans
Brothers are slaying brothers
Patriots are betraying compatriots
Mothers and children now refuge under bridges
The old and the weak abandoned to their fades 

Where have we kept our forefathers’ legacies?
They taught us love and oneness
Trained us to stand for uprightness
Showed us how to be compassionate
Nelson Mandela fought for love, peace, unity and justice
He had a dream for African unity and not Afrophobia  
Kwame Nkrumah advocated for African freedom 
He did not promote African terrorism 

Africans, Africans... where are you?
Stand up and drop your arms 
Drop all weapons of destruction against Africa
Embrace your fellow Africans with love 
Unite and put an end to racism and discrimination
Rise above your selfishness and stop xenophobia
Africans, we are one and indivisible Africa 
Together, we can put an end to all xenophobic attacks!

TANGWA LIVINUS ACHA
UNIVERSITY OF YAOUNDE II, SOA
20th April 2015
